About Nonprofit Technology Conference
NTEN’s conference — often referred to as the NTC — is the annual gathering of people who want to make the world a better place through the skillful and equitable use of technology. The NTC has something for people in all roles in nonprofit technology, from those brand new to their job to expert practitioners. Attendees include nonprofit staff, volunteers, board members, funders, consultants, and tech vendors.
Historically, we have created unique branding each year for the NTC. We now want to standardize and templatize the branding from last year (25NTC) to create an evergreen NTC brand, which serves as a sub-brand of the NTEN brand. As such, we have existing assets, logo, and iconography from the 25NTC brand to base this scope of work on. We aim to transform this into a standardized, general NTC brand that can be reused each year.
